- The Tokyo Marui 1851 Spring Revolver is a fantastic replica of an old western revolver.
- A similar variant is used by "Blondie" played by Clint Eastwood in the famous western "The Good, The Bad, and The Ugly".
- This particular model is based on the M1851 Navy, The decorative engraving on the cylinder depicting the "Battle of Campeche" is reproduced by laser marking.
- The grip is painted with woodgrain paint, and the front sight is made by cutting brass.
- Realistic markings on barrel & cylinder of pistol.
- Although this is a plastic spring action model gun that is marketed for younger players, this gun is so much fun! Note that this pistol is only 450g, so quite a bit lighter than you might expect.
- The internal frame is made of metal parts to increase rigidity and eliminate distortion when the hammer is cocked.
- As you would expect from Marui, despite the near all-plastic construction, it looks convincingly realistic, with no rattles or plastic creaking.
- This is a spring powered gun, so no gas or CO2 required, yet it still has all the same functions as its gas counterparts.
- If you cock the gun by mistake, you can manually decock it without firing it.
- The hammer is smooth to operate, it is quite similar to the gas and CO2 counterparts.
- The gun in contrast to most airsoft revolvers has an adjustable hop-up which can be adjusted by hand, which significantly increases its range since this gun has a low FPS and it is designed to use 0.12 gram BBs.
- Remember this was designed for children of the age 10 and above, so it is still a basic plinker as opposed to a long range, skirmishable or collectors piece.
- Fires at: 120fps
- Weighs: 450g
- Length: 339mm
